Capt. Ajay Yadav, Minister of Power, Environment and Forests, Haryana has claimed that the State now has surplus power capacity. As per him, Haryana has 10,635 MW of installed power capacity and a current production capability of 5,300 MW. The maximum demand is 8,000 MW. In this scenario, he believes that it is possible to plan for a supply of 23 hours of electricity to the cities and Industrial areas. He was speaking at a seminar on ‘Power Scenario in Haryana - Prospects and Practical Solutions - Present & Future’, organised by NCR Chamber of Commerce and Industry, Gurgaon. He instructed DHBVN to inform industry regarding the schedule of power cuts in their sector. Sanjeev Chopra, General Manager, DHBVN, Gurgaon was also present.
